St. Martinus-Krankenhaus is a multidisciplinary clinic which includes 3 specialized centers and 6 departments, namely, of Ophthalmology, Therapy, General and Visceral Surgery, Traumatology, Geriatrics, and Anesthesiology and Intensive Care.
All centers have passed the accreditation of influential medical associations.
Obesity Center
The Center is headed by Dr. Matthias Schlensak who has managed to involve in his team many experienced surgeons as well as other specialists like dietitians, personal coaches, and behavioral therapists. It means that the treatment here is based on the interdisciplinary approach which increases the therapy’s effectiveness.
The physicians of St. Martinus-Krankenhaus perform both traditional bariatric surgeries and innovative interventions.
Standard minimally invasive surgeries
|
Gastric sleeve resection |
The removal of the part of the stomach with high concentration of gastrin (“hunger hormone”). |
|
Gastric Bypasses |
During the operation only a small part of the stomach continues functioning. The surgeons use a bypass through the middle or back part of the intestine. |
|
Gastric balloon |
The balloon is reduced to the stomach size and placed inside it using endoscopic techniques. Such procedure promotes quicker saturation. |
|
Gastric band |
Laparoscopic placement of the ring on the upper third of the stomach, which helps to get rid of the feeling of hunger more quickly. |
Innovative minimally invasive surgeries
|
Gastroplication |
A specialized surgery which reduces the gastric lumen by suturing the stomach. The procedure has some contraindications. |
|
Endobarrier |
A non-invasive therapeutic method for the patients with type 2 diabetes and obesity, during which a thin liner is inserted into primary and middle sections of the small intestine. The liner prevents interaction of food with these sections and is removed after the therapy. |
|
OPTIFAST |
The program conducts monitoring of the patients with the most complex forms of obesity. It helps to choose different approaches which are divided into phases. |
